Rams [Rams] Rams QB Marc Bulger Admits This Is His Last Shot

Rams quarterback Marc Bulger told the media that he realizes that this season is probably his last chance as a starter for the Rams. "I understand we have to win," Bulger told FOXSports.com after a recent offseason practice. "It's not fair to our fans or the ownership. If we don't, I know it starts with me. It's probably my final chance." After being a perennial Pro Bowler early in his career, Bulger has been a major disappointment over the last few years as the Rams have turned into one of the worst teams in the league.
